INCREASINGLY, NATIONAL TO LOCAL POLICIES STRIVE TO REDUCE THE COSTS OF ACHIEVING SUSTAINABILITY GOALS OR TO ENHANCE INCENTIVES FOR THE ECONOMY TO RECOGNIZE THE VALUE OF ENVIRONMENTAL BENEFITS TO SOCIETY. THESE INITIATIVES CAN STIMULATE MARKET OPPORTUNITIES RELATED TO ENVIRONMENTAL BENEFITS THAT AGRICULTURE CAN INFLUENCE, PRODUCE, OR SELL. SUCH OPPORTUNITIES CAN ENHANCE AGRICULTURAL VIABILITY AND CAN SUSTAIN RURAL COMMUNITIES CONSISTENT WITH ENVIRONMENTAL STEWARDSHIP. IN MANY CASES, NON-AGRICULTURAL INDUSTRIES ARE SUBJECT TO ENVIRONMENTAL COMPLIANCE STANDARDS AND WATER QUALITY CAP-AND-TRADE MARKETS GENERATE OPPORTUNITIES FOR AGRICULTURAL PRODUCERS TO PARTICIPATE VOLUNTARILY IN PROVIDING OFFSETS. AGRICULTURE CAN PRODUCE POLLUTION OFFSETS THROUGH ADOPTION OF BEST MANAGEMENT PRACTICES (BMPS) THAT REDUCE NUTRIENTS ENTERING RIVERS AND WATER BODIES AND THEREBY GENERATE A CREDIT THAT CAN BE SOLD TO OFFSET POLLUTION FROM REGULATED INDUSTRIAL POINT-SOURCES.THIS PROPOSAL OFFERS TO ADVANCE THE VALUATION OF ECOSYSTEM SERVICES (SOMETIMES CALLED ANCILLARY OR CO-BENEFITS) PRODUCED IN CONNECTION WITH WATER QUALITY CREDITS ARISING FROM AGRICULTURAL BMPS. WE OFFER TO EXPLORE HOW CONSERVATION-BUYERS COULD CONNECT THESE VALUES TO CREDIT PRODUCTION AND REVENUES FOR AGRICULTURAL PRODUCERS. WE WILL MAKE THE CONNECTION IN PART BY (I) PROVIDING AN APPROACH (KNOWLEDGE) THAT COULD SUPPORT ON-THE-GROUND DECISIONS TO ENCOURAGE ALTERNATIVE SUBSETS OF CO-BENEFITS THROUGH INVESTMENT CHOICES REGARDING BMPS FOR WATER QUALITY AND BY (II) DEMONSTRATING HOW A PUBLIC AGENT, PERHAPS ACTING THROUGH AN INDEPENDENT (NON-PROFIT) PARTNER, COULD USE VALUATION METHODS TO INJECT THE SOCIAL VALUE OF CO-BENEFITS INTO EXISTING WATER QUALITY TRADING EXCHANGES. WE WILL CONDUCT EXPERIMENTS THAT NOT ONLY MEASURE THE VALUE OF CO-BENEFITS FOR A SUBSET OF THE PUBLIC, BUT ALSO LEVERAGE A NEW WATER QUALITY TRADING PLATFORM TO ENHANCE OUR UNDERSTANDING OF THE CONCEPTUAL AND EMPIRICAL FOUNDATIONS FOR NON-MARKET VALUATION BASED ON STATED-PREFERENCE (SP) METHODS, PARTICULARLY CHOICE EXPERIMENTS (CES), OR SURVEYS DESIGNED TO MEASURE ENVIRONMENTAL VALUES OF CITIZENS.THIS PROPOSAL WILL ADVANCE THE VALUATION OF ECOSYSTEM SERVICES IN CONNECTION WITH WATER QUALITY CREDITS ARISING FROM AGRICULTURAL BMPS. WE WILL EXPLORE HOW CONSERVATION-BUYERS COULD ENHANCE NEW REVENUES FOR AGRICULTURE. THE STUDY WILL EXTEND OUR UNDERSTANDING OF CONSEQUENTIALITY IN VALUATION SURVEYS SUPPORTING REAL DECISIONS, THROUGH AN EXPERIMENTAL APPROACH THAT LEVERAGES THE OHIO RIVER BASIN WATER QUALITY TRADING, COORDINATED BY THE ELECTRIC POWER RESEARCH INSTITUTE (EPRI). OUR PRIMARY OBJECTIVES ARE: (1) TO MODEL CHOICE PREFERENCES OF RESIDENTS IN THE OHIO RIVER STATES WHO ARE WILLING TO ENTER ENVIRONMENTAL MARKETS AND TO MODEL THEIR WILLINGNESS TO PURCHASE WATER QUALITY CREDITS IN RELATION TO CO-BENEFITS FROM BMPS; (2) TO EXTEND OUR UNDERSTANDING OF SP VALUATION METHODS RELATIVE THE CONSEQUENTIALITY OF SURVEY RESPONSES, EXPERIMENTS COVERING A SP,ECTRUM OF CONSEQUENTIAL OUTCOME-CRITERIA LINKED TO ACTUAL CREDIT TRANSACTIONS; (3) TO DEMONSTRATE HOW A CONSERVATION BUYER COULD INJECT VALUES OF CO-BENEFITS IN AN AUCTION FOR WATER QUALITY CREDITS; (4) TO DEVELOP A MODEL FOR HOW CO-BENEFITS COULDINCREASE SALES OR ENHANCE REVENUES OR INVESTMENT IN BMPS THAT RETURN CO-BENEFITS (OR ECOSYSTEM SERVICES) THAT REMAIN EXTERNAL TO A REGULATORY MARKET.THE APPROACH WILL TEST-BED METHODS IN LABORATORY EXPERIMENTS TO IMPROVE FIELD EXPERIMENTS COST EFFECTIVELY PRIOR TO DEPLOYMENT. THE COLLABORATION WITH EPRI RAISES THE POTENTIAL FOR NOT ONLY ACADEMIC ADVANCES, BUT ALSO IMPACTS ON POLICY AND MANAGEMENT CHOICES THROUGH KNOWLEDGE GENERATED.
